Overview

This on-site IT Network Infrastructure Administrator role provides support for network, server, storage, enterprise software, and maintaining access controls. Working with the IT Network and Infrastructure teams, this position acts as an on-site resource to troubleshoot and deploy necessary systems. While utilizing a service desk ticketing system, the role also involves long-term projects related to site development and end-user systems.

Responsibilities

Network Administration (70% Focus)

  • Prepare and configure network equipment such as switches, routers, and firewalls before deployment.
  • Ensure all equipment is tested and ready for installation.
  • Install and secure network equipment in racks within the IDF.
  • Connect and organize cables to maintain a neat and efficient layout.
  • Perform physical setup and installation of network hardware.
  • Install and terminate low-voltage/fiber cabling for data networks.
  • Ensure all cabling meets industry standards and best practices.
  • Test and certify network cables for proper performance.
  • Document all network configurations, changes, and updates.
  • Configure and manage network monitoring tools to ensure all equipment is properly monitored.
  • Maintain accurate and up-to-date records of network infrastructure.
  • Assist in troubleshooting network issues and providing support to end-users.
  • Work with senior network administrators to resolve complex network problems.
  • Ensure that all equipment and installations at remote locations meet company standards.

Infrastructure (30% Focus)

  • Install, configure, and maintain Linux servers and related software across various distributions (e.g., Ubuntu, CentOS, Red Hat).
  • Ensure system security by implementing best practices and conducting regular security audits.
  • Monitor system performance, troubleshoot issues, and ensure efficient operation of servers.
  • Automate routine tasks and system deployments using scripting languages (e.g., Bash, PowerShell, Python) and automation tools (e.g., Ansible, SALT, Terraform).
  • Manage virtualization technologies and containerization (e.g., VMware, Docker, Kubernetes, LXC).
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to support infrastructure needs and address system-related issues.
  • Develop and maintain comprehensive documentation for system architectures, configurations, procedures, and best practices.
